Can't Catch or Throw

The softball team has started out surprisingly 2-0. In the last inning they were trailing by one with one out and runners on first and second. Yours truly fielded a hard hit ball at third and started the double play to win the game. The ball was hit so hard that I had plenty of time to throw to first after touching the bag. Like many things in life sometimes you're just better off going on reaction and instinct. I took my time and then easily made my worst throw of the game. Fortunately the first baseman made a great pick.

Answers...

In response to TripJax:

1. What is the biggest mistake people make at a NL table?

Trying to get too fancy when the game / situation rarely justifies it.

2. What is the biggest mistake people make at a Limit table?

Playing with sub-par starting hands in early / middle position.

3. Why do you play poker?

I covered this in more detail several years ago: the competition, having fun and socializing with my friends. The money is mostly an afterthought and a measure of my success in the competition category.

4. If you weren't playing poker, what would you be doing?

Poker is one of the many hobbies I enjoy. If I played less poker I would probably read more.

5. What is your favorite poker book and why?

The Harrington tournament books are great. They've really helped me improve my game as the blinds increase.

6. Who is your favorite poker player and why?

Probably Ted Forrest. He's exceptional at many different poker games and his reads are completely sick sometimes.

7. Which poker player do you dislike the most and why?

Any of the loud assholes.

Wednesday, May 03, 2006

Tech Support

I'm pretty much a technology geek. I first got hooked on my Grandfather's Commodore VIC-20. Then my family got an 8086 and the rest is history. As mentioned previously my educational background is Chemical Engineering, but before and during college I worked IT jobs...including a four year stint with the USPS. First day on the job I cracked a gun joke that went over like a lead zeppelin.

With two children my time is much more limited though I still screw around with Linux distributions and thinks like PHP, just for fun.

Queue Friday evening where I started experiencing some strange networking issues with my main computer.

-----
I guess I should briefly explain how our home network is setup. The cable modem and wireless router are on one side of the basement and I've got a long Cat5 cable above the suspending ceiling that connects to a switch in my computer / play room. Off that switch I have several computers, printers, etc. Including the one with the network issues
-----

XP would pop up the "Cable unplugged" message and for a few seconds I'd lose all contact with the internet and other computers on our network. The delay was short enough that I wouldn't time out on poker tables, but it sure made downloading and other activities pure hell.

I switched ports on the switch, Cat5 cables, Ethernet cards and eventually came back to the switch. I had originally ruled the switch out since my other computers didn't seem to have the same problem. Well, it was the switch. Sunday I ordered a cheap replacement off Newegg and today it is working like a champ!
